Intellectus Partners LLC cut its holdings in Maplebear Inc. (NASDAQ:CART – Free Report) by 10.0% during the fourth qu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The firm owned 22,500 shares of the company’s stock after selling 2,500 shares during the quarter. Intellectus Partners LLC’s holdings in Maplebear were worth $932,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Maplebear Stock Up 5.7 %
NASDAQ CART opened at $39.90 on Friday. Maplebear Inc. has a 52 week low of $29.84 and a 52 week high of $53.44. The company has a market capitalization of $10.25 billion, a P/E ratio of 26.78,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 1.19 and a beta of 1.34. The stock’s 50-day moving average price is $45.99 and its 200-day moving average price is $42.94.
Analyst Ratings Changes
Several equities analysts have recently weighed in on CART shares. Piper Sandler raised their price target on Maplebear from $50.00 to $58.00 and gave the company an “overweight” rating in a report on Wednesday, November 13th. BTIG Research upgraded shares of Maplebear from a “neutral” rating to a “buy” rating and set a $58.00 price objective for the company in a research note on Tuesday, January 14th. Wells Fargo & Company began coverage on shares of Maplebear in a report on Friday, January 10th. They issued an “equal weight” rating and a $47.00 target price for the company. BMO Capital Markets increased their price target on shares of Maplebear from $48.00 to $49.00 and gave the company a “market perform” rating in a report on Wednesday, February 26th. Finally, Mizuho decreased their price objective on shares of Maplebear from $55.00 to $52.00 and set an “outperform” rating for the company in a report on Wednesday, February 26th. Thirteen analysts have rated the stock with a hold rating, sixteen have assigned a buy rating and one has assigned a strong buy rating to the company. Based on data from MarketBeat, Maplebear presently has a consensus rating of “Moderate Buy” and a consensus target price of $50.21.

Insider Activity at Maplebear
In related news, CAO Alan Ramsay sold 2,314 shares of Maplebear stock in a transaction that occurred on Tuesday, January 21st. The stock was sold at an average price of $46.28, for a total transaction of $107,091.92. Following the sale, the chief accounting officer now owns 85,421 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$3,953,283.88. This trade represents a 2.64 % decrease in their position. About Maplebear
Maplebear Inc, doing business as Instacart, engages in the provision of online grocery shopping services to households in North America. It sells and delivers grocery products, as well as pickup services through a mobile application and website. It also operates virtual convenience stores; and provides software-as-a-service solutions to retailers.
